Iranian Foreign Ministry spokesperson Nasser Kanani said on Monday that Iran “does not seek to escalate tensions in the region” and that its attack on Israel was a “legitimate response” to Israel’s alleged strike on the Iranian consulate in Syria.
“Iran’s action was completely legitimate and in accordance with the United Nations Charter” granting states the right to self-defense, Kanani said. He added that the United States and the international community at large should “appreciate” Iran’s “responsible behavior.”
